The usage of artificial intelligence (AI) in coding is shifting the position of software program growth, however measuring strains of code is not a legitimate measure of developer productiveness, a survey by AI software program supply platform Harness has discovered.
The poll of 700 software developers and managers throughout the US, the UK, India, France and Germany discovered that though 89% consider productiveness metrics have improved, 81% stated they’re now spending extra time reviewing AI-generated supply code.
The survey discovered that when AI generates code, metrics that measure software program growth output enhance and software program growth cycle instances shorten. The builders surveyed stated they really feel extra productive as a result of AI means they will write extra code, are in a position to sort out extra advanced issues and might to maneuver sooner by acquainted work. Nevertheless, the survey additionally revealed that one of many main drawbacks in utilizing AI is that developer time spent on code assessment has elevated dramatically.
The present state of AI-based instruments implies that persons are usually saved within the loop to keep away from mishaps, and the necessity for having a human within the loop is going on in software program growth.
On common, the survey reported that 31% of a developer’s day is now consumed by AI-related invisible work that isn’t being measured. Once we requested them the place AI creates probably the most friction, 53% put reviewing AI-generated code as inflicting probably the most friction of their work. Over half (52%) stated that probably the most friction was being attributable to having to repair delicate bugs in AI code, whereas 48% stated that having to elucidate the AI-generated code to teammates was inflicting them probably the most friction.
Nevertheless, organisations are likely to measure gross output by way of the quantity of code generated. In accordance with Harness, they aren’t measuring the place the productiveness positive aspects are being spent.
When requested whether or not they’re frightened about using AI instruments to measure their performance, 96% of the builders polled stated they’re frightened. Most builders who took half within the survey (94%) stated tech debt, validation time and developer burnout are lacking from their present metric. Over half (54%) expressed considerations over particular person efficiency evaluations primarily based on AI information.
Harness urges IT managers to trace AI assessment time, debugging overhead and the price of productiveness misplaced as a result of builders having to modify between completely different environments. For example, Harness really useful investigating a reported 20% acquire alongside an unmeasured 31% overhead earlier than planning the following funding cycle.
It additionally really useful that software program growth organisations inside companies perceive totally the amount of code that’s being accomplished, merged and deployed. Whereas AI will increase code quantity, as Harness factors out, it doesn’t routinely improve code supply.
“AI coding is the primary expertise shift in fashionable software program that has modified not simply what builders construct, however how they spend their hours,” stated Trevor Stuart, senior vice-president and basic supervisor at Harness. “AI is reshaping the developer’s job fully, and the measurement frameworks that the business has relied on for the previous decade weren’t constructed for this new unit of labor.”








